More than 50 award-winning GCSE and A level art students from East Sussex secondary schools and colleges gathered at Farleys House and Gallery, Chiddingly last month (October 18) to find out the winners of the Farley Arts Trust Awards.

Judges said that choosing the 16 winners was ‘even more difficult than usual’ this year, with the standard being ‘outstanding’.

Prizes were donated by national and local sponsors and were presented by Sir Peter Blake, a pop artist best known for co-creating the sleeve design for the Beatles’ album Sgt. Pepper’s Lonely Hearts Club Band and the artwork for two of The Who’s albums.
